The pulmonary blood volume variation is higher in patients with heart failure compared to healthy controls

چکیده

Background In left ventricular heart failure, blood will congest backwards to the pulmonary circulation and result in an increased pulmonary vascular resistance. If the increase in pressure result in impaired gas exchange due to pulmonary oedema, the pulmonary blood will redistribute to better ventilated areas in order to maintain adequate gas exchange[1]. This might affect the pulsatility of the pulmonary blood flow which can be quantified by measuring the pulmonary blood volume variation (PBVV)[2]. Therefore, the aim of this study was to investigate if PBVV in patients with heart failure differed from healthy controls.
